Master Afzal Hussain Stitched the First Pakistani Flag on 3rd June 1947 after Partition Announcement
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sapp

Master Afzal Hussain is a name that many may not know, but his contribution to Pakistan’s history is truly remarkable. He is the unsung hero who sewed Pakistan’s first flag, a powerful symbol of the nation’s pride and identity.

Despite his significant role, Master Afzal Hussain lived his life in quiet obscurity, unknown to the wider public. The flag, designed by Ameer-ud-din Qudwai, was brought to life by Master Afzal Hussain and his brother, Altaf Hussain, in June 1947, just two months before Pakistan gained its independence.

The brothers’ careful craftsmanship transformed a design into a symbol that would represent the hopes and dreams of millions.

Master Afzal Hussain’s legacy is a powerful example of the selflessness and dedication shown by Pakistan’s hidden heroes. Though his work was crucial, he never sought recognition or fame. His family continues to live a modest life, largely unaware of the significant impact their patriarch had on the nation’s history.
